The Cartwick load-testing harness replays recorded checkout sessions against the staging payment stack. New team members should start with the small profile (50 virtual shoppers) before scaling up, since the inventory service throttles aggressively. Results land in the shared metrics dashboard automatically. Every harness run authenticates against the internal orchestrator using the key below.

gateway credential: kto3_qfe

## SQL Linting: Environments

Heads up: Squidgeon, our SQL linter, now runs in every environment's merge gate, not just prod-bound branches. Dev is lenient (warnings only), staging fails on errors, and prod-release blocks on anything above info. If a hotfix is stuck on a lint failure, don't bypass it—ping the tooling channel instead. Each environment picks up its ruleset from the values below.

service settings:
[casax]
port = 6379
team = rusir
host = casax.zemvarhq.corp
region = outer-4
access_code = ac_9808ce
timeout_ms = 1500

Alert: Splitpane diff viewer timeout. This fires when the Splitpane service takes longer than thirty seconds to render a diff, almost always on files over fifty megabytes. The renderer falls back to chunked mode automatically, but repeated firings suggest the chunker itself is degraded. Restarting the worker pool usually clears it. The triage checklist is on the internal page below.

operations page: https://jenkins.zemvarcloud.local/job/merge_requests/repo/build/73930b4b30f0a8ed

## Onboarding: Farebranch Rules Engine

Plugin authors integrate with Farebranch by registering fee rules against the evaluation API. Rules are sandboxed; they cannot perform network calls directly. All rate-table lookups go through the host, which validates your plugin manifest at load time. Your local env file must include the signing credential the host uses to verify manifests, set on the next line.

secret setting of bajef-fajof: COURIER_KEY3=76c

MEMO — Kettling Depot Receiving

Uniform sets for the new Kettling depot arrive Wednesday via Ashgrove courier: 40 boxes, sorted by size, manifest attached to box one. Check the count at the dock before signing; shortages go straight to stores, not the courier. The hand-over instruction the courier will follow is set out below.

drop instructions, tafof-baguf: the holmir gilox courier leaves the sormir ulaok holdor ledger at gate 5596 under passcode 257343